LEARNING OF OLDER MEN IN VOLUNTARY ASSOCIATIONS Author(s): Marko Radovan ,Sabina Jelenc Krasovec, Spela Mocilnikar J. Ponte - Sep 2016 - Volume 72 - Issue 9 doi: 10.21506/j.ponte.2016.9.4 Abstract: Learning and education can have an important influence on strengthening social networks of older people, giving different kinds of social support and diminish their exclusion (Jelenc Krašovec & Kump, 2009), but also influence community well-being (Golding, 2011). The research show that in urban areas in Slovenia there is more educational offer for older adults in educational institutions, but in rural areas the voluntary association (VAs) play more important role in social activities and learning of older people (Jelenc Krašovec & Kump, 2012). The methodology of our research is based on a successive use of quantitative and qualitative methods (Creswell & Plano Clark, 2011). First we performed a quantitative survey of the state of art of VAs in selected quarters in Ljubljana, and supplemented it with primary research, i.e., case studies. In the case study research we will use triangulation of research methods.
